Hawk extends the regular EOL facilities to be able to query the metamodels registered within the instance:
Model.types
lists all the types registered in Hawk (EClass
instances for EMF).Model.metamodels
lists all the metamodels registered in Hawk (EPackage
instances for EMF).Model.files
lists all the files indexed by Hawk (may be limited through the context).Model.getTypeOf(obj)
retrieves the type of the object obj
.Model.getFileOf(obj)
retrieves the first file containing the object obj
.Model.getFilesOf(obj)
retrieves all the files containing the object obj
.For a metamodel mm
, these attributes are available:
mm.uri
is the namespace URI of the metamodel.mm.metamodelType
is the type of metamodel that was registered.mm.dependencies
lists the metamodels this metamodel depends on (usually at least the Ecore metamodel for EMF-based metamodels).mm.types
lists the types defined in this metamodel.mm.resource
retrieves the original string representation for this metamodel (the original .ecore
file for EMF).For a type t
, these attributes are available:
t.metamodel
retrieves the metamodel that defines the type.t.all
retrieves all instances of that type efficiently (includes subtypes).t.name
retrieves the name of the type.t.attributes
lists the attributes of the type, as slots (see below).t.references
lists the references of the type, as slots.t.features
lists the attributes and references of the type.For a slot sl
, these attributes are available:
sl.name
: name of the slot.sl.type
: type of the value of the slot.sl.isMany
: true if this is a multi-valued slot.sl.isOrdered
: true if the values should follow some order.sl.isAttribute
: true if this is an attribute slot.sl.isReference
: true if this is a reference slot.sl.isUnique
: true if the value for this slot should be unique within its model.For a file f
, these attributes are available:
f.path
: returns the path of the file within the repository (e.g. /input.xmi
).f.repository
: returns the URL of the repository (e.g. file:///home/myuser/models
).f.roots
: returns the root model elements in the file.f.contents
: returns all the model elements in the file.
